A bay window in an eat-in kitchen typically lends itself well to a round dining table and chairs. In this modern kitchen, the bay window houses a mid-century modern style dining set and woven wood shades keep the nook bright and open, bringing in a textured element and a little bit of privacy and shade without the heaviness of long drapes. A bay window is a window that projects outward from the wall of a building, typically consisting of three or more casement windows that are angled to form a bay.
